Unit/Position Summary
The Occupational Health Clinics specialize in treating patients with occupational injuries and illnesses, and provides additional services including, but not limited to, pre-employment physical exams, DOT and non-DOT drug screening, hearing and vision screening, respiratory fit testing and immunizations. The Occupational Health provider manages the injured worker's return to work and work restrictions and facilitates referrals to specialty services where appropriate.
The MA is responsible for assisting licensed providers with patient care, charting within the patient's EMR and has working knowledge and skills developed through formal training. Responsibilities
- Interviews patients, measures vital signs, and records information on patients' charts.
- Prepares treatment rooms for examination of patients. Sterilizes, cleans, and performs checks on medical equipment.
- Provides technical, clinical, and clerical support to provider and/or physician.
- Performs medical procedures as outlined by provider and/or physician.
- Processes prescription medication for refill under the supervision of a licensed independent provider (LIP).
- Assists physicians in patient exams and office procedures. Prepares basic laboratory tests on premises and prepares laboratory specimens.
- Enters diagnostic or medication orders under the direction of a licensed independent provider (LIP).
- Other duties and responsibilities as assigned.
